Perfect Square
4148689747855687919552732141068731664395028640289 is a perfect square (2036833264618311343321233 × 2036833264618311343321233)
4148689747855687919552732141068731664395028640289 is a perfect square (2036833264618311343321233 × 2036833264618311343321233)
4148689747855687919552732141068731664395028640289 is odd
Previous odd number is 4148689747855687919552732141068731664395028640287
Next odd number is 4148689747855687919552732141068731664395028640291
101101011010110001101011101010110011001011111110000000111010001110000111110101010110011111100111110100110000110011010010110001011001111001001010111011001000100001
71405698918754853065397065174014079392402241583005270900992349410071285194921269697783456756855605319775953368233135513098842340720711964348457569
17211626623962891406692563134646892349156348242998252017110427279079026505203488448440576154003521